public Processor open(OpenContext context)
AbstractDevice
By default, open() does nothing and returns the device itself as the Processor (or null if it is not openable): AbstractDevice implements both Device and Processor interfaces, so that you can add processing code directly into the device.
If you want to add specialization features, subclass this method to return a specific processor implementation depending on your device configuration.
Example :
public Processor getProcessor() {
if (super.open() == null)
return null;
// Select the right processor
if (in2.isValid()) {
return new twoParamProcessor(in1, in2, out);
else
return new oneParamProcessor(in1, out);
}
In this method, you may also perform all necessary pre-running initialization. If initialization fails, return null even if isOpenable() returns true.
In all cases, return null if isOpenable() returns false.

public boolean hasExternalOutput()
AbstractDevice
Return false if the device has no border effects. Most of input and processing devices are in this case.
Return true if the device has border effects, such as graphical feedback, or control of some external value. Examples of devices with external output are application-interfacing devices and all user feedback devices.
This method can be used by the editor for the device's graphical representation. However there is at now no clear definition of what is external output.
